About our group and team
Our Group, Te Pae Aronui provides integrated operational support to our regions for their work with the education sector and others to deliver inclusive education that meets the needs of akonga and whanau.
The purpose of the Strategy and Implementation team is to lead the collaborative development and iteration of strategic initiatives within Te Pae Aronui in alignment with the Ministry’s vision and priorities. We translate policy decisions into collaborative, coherent, fit-for-purpose service design, ensuring implementation by regional leads is well supported at the national level.
